Breach Of Contract: Case Filed Against Kapil Sharma; Know Details

New Delhi: An event management company in the USA has filed a case against Kapil Sharma for breach of contract during the tour of North America in 2015.

According to a lawsuit filed by SAI USA Inc, the comedian was paid for six shows but performed only five. Despite the comedian promising to compensate for the loss, he hasn’t performed the remaining show in seven years or returned the money.

The issue has come up at a time when Kapil is on a fresh tour of North America with his team of The Kapil Sharma Show for Kapil Sharma Live performances. Kapil, along with Sumona Chakravarti, Rajiv Thakur, Kiku Sharda, Chandan Prabhakar and Krushna Abhishek, has performed in Vancouver and Toronto so far.

Amit Jaitly-helmed SAI USA Inc, based out of New Jersey, took to Facebook to share a report on the case.

“He did not perform and has not responded although we tried several times to get in touch with him before the court,” Jaitly was quoted as saying by The Times of India.

The case is pending in a New York court.
